This content originally appeared on DEV Community and was authored by JetThoughts Dev
The intelligence of artificial intelligence hinges on high-quality data. A recent guide highlights the critical role of effective data labeling systems in machine learning pipelines, emphasizing how accurate and consistent data annotation is fundamental for training robust and unbiased AI models. This process, from collection to deployment, is vital for AI's success.
The Cornerstone of AI: Understanding Data Labeling
Data labeling is the process of annotating raw information to provide context and meaning, crucial for training machine learning models. This annotation improves model accuracy by highlighting what the system needs to recognize. Without quality labeling, models can exhibit biases and inaccuracies, leading to the adage, "Garbage in, garbage out."
- Supervised Learning's Reliance: Most modern ML models use supervised learning, which depends heavily on labeled training data. This data allows models to learn mappings between inputs and correct outputs.
- The Labeling Pipeline: The process involves data collection, preprocessing (cleaning and formatting), labeling (often with human intervention for accuracy), quality assurance (QA) to ensure consistency, model training, testing, and finally, deployment and monitoring.
Navigating Data Labeling Types and Methods
Different data types, such as text, images, audio, and video, require distinct labeling approaches. Multimodal models combine various data types, necessitating complex annotation to capture interrelationships.
- Diverse Data, Diverse Techniques: Computer vision involves categorizing images and videos, while natural language processing (NLP) uses sentiment analysis or named entity recognition for text. Audio data might be transcribed or classified.
- Human-in-the-Loop (HTL): This hybrid approach combines AI automation with human validation, offering efficiency and scalability while maintaining accuracy. AI pre-labels data, and humans review and correct it, improving the system iteratively.
Choosing the Right Data Labeling System Components
Selecting the appropriate tools is crucial for an efficient and reliable data labeling workflow. Options range from open-source to commercial platforms, or even custom in-house solutions.
- Data Collection and Storage: Data can be gathered manually or automatically, with open-source datasets and cloud storage (Amazon S3, Google Cloud Storage) offering scalable solutions.
- Annotation Tools: Platforms like Doccano, LabelStudio (open-source), and Labelbox, Supervisely (commercial) streamline the labeling process. Commercial tools often provide advanced features like AI-assisted pre-labeling and comprehensive QA.
- Quality Assurance: QA teams review labels for accuracy, often using methods like double-labeling and statistical models (e.g., Dawid-Skene) to achieve consensus. Commercial tools offer more advanced QA functionalities.
Ensuring Quality and Security in Data Labeling
Maintaining accuracy, addressing bias, and ensuring privacy are paramount in data labeling.
- Improving Accuracy: Clear annotation guidelines, inter-annotator agreement (IAA) metrics, and rigorous error detection (automated and human-reviewed) are vital. Continuous learning from errors refines the process.
- Addressing Bias: Diverse labeling teams, double-labeling, and representative datasets help mitigate bias. Data augmentation techniques (e.g., image flipping, text paraphrasing) increase dataset diversity. External oversight can also provide valuable recommendations.
- Data Privacy and Security: Platforms must integrate security features like encryption and multi-factor authentication. Anonymizing personally identifiable information and complying with regulations like GDPR and HIPAA are essential. SOC 2 Type 2 certification indicates adherence to trust principles.
Future-Proofing Your Data Labeling System
Data labeling systems must be adaptable to evolving requirements and scaling needs.
- Scalability: Cloud-based solutions offer dynamic scaling of storage and processing. Modular design and integration of open-source libraries enhance adaptability.
- Workforce Management: The annotating workforce must also scale efficiently, with effective training and onboarding processes for new labelers. Managed labeling services or on-demand annotators can provide flexible scaling.
This content originally appeared on DEV Community and was authored by JetThoughts Dev

JetThoughts Dev | Sciencx (2025-06-03T21:23:09+00:00) Mastering Data Labeling: The Key to Effective Machine Learning. Retrieved from https://www.scien.cx/2025/06/03/mastering-data-labeling-the-key-to-effective-machine-learning/
Please log in to upload a file.
There are no updates yet.
Click the Upload button above to add an update.